What is a no experience proofreader?

A No Experience Proofreader job is an entry-level position where you review and correct written content for grammar, spelling, punctuation, and clarity without needing prior professional experience. Employers may look for strong language skills, attention to detail, and a good grasp of grammar rules. Some companies provide training or style guides to help beginners improve. Freelance opportunities are also available, allowing you to build experience while working on various projects.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a no experience proofreader?

To thrive as a No Experience Proofreader, you need excellent attention to detail, strong grammar and spelling skills, and a solid command of the English language, even if you lack formal proofreading experience. Familiarity with word processing software like Microsoft Word or Google Docs, and optional online grammar tools such as Grammarly, can be helpful. Strong communication, a willingness to learn, and good time management make candidates stand out in this entry-level role. These skills are essential to ensure accuracy, meet deadlines, and work effectively with clients or editorial teams.

What kind of training or support is typically provided for no experience proofreader positions?

Many employers offer onboarding sessions or self-guided resources to help new proofreaders get acclimated to their specific style guides and workflow processes. You may receive feedback from more experienced editors or work alongside a team to refine your skills and understand project expectations. Entry-level positions often include gradual increases in responsibility, allowing you to build confidence and proficiency over time. This supportive environment helps candidates with no prior experience develop the necessary skills for long-term success.

RESPONSIBILITIES

  • Grammar Guardian:Review customer-facing content for spelling, punctuation, grammar, syntax, clarity, consistency, and style. Catch the mistakes others might miss and ensure every piece of content is polished and professional.

  • Brand Protector:Safeguard the voice, tone, terminology, formatting, and standards of six iconic brands, helping every asset feel consistent andon-brandacross channels and customer touchpoints.

  • Offer & Detail Detective:Validateoffers, pricing, product names, SKUs, imagery, timelines, disclaimers, legal language, links, calls-to-action, and other critical details against approved source materials. If somethingdoesn'tadd up,you'llfind it.

  • Quality Checkpoint:Serve as a critical review point throughout the project lifecycle.Confirmrequested changes have been implemented accurately before stakeholder review, production, deployment, or launch.

  • Output Confirmer:Make sure final copy and content align with approved designs, data, briefs, and client-provided inputs across print and digital deliverables.

  • Digital Experience Reviewer:Evaluate websites, mobile applications, emails, landing pages, banners, and digital campaigns for content accuracy, visual consistency, functionality, accessibility, and production readiness. Great experiencesdon'thappen by accident, and neither does great QA.

  • Risk Spotter:Identify, document, and communicate issues before they affect customers, brand standards, compliance, timelines, or campaign delivery. Partner with teams to resolve concerns before theybecomecostly mistakes.

  • Process Builder:Help improve proofreading checklists, documentation, workflows, style guides, and quality standards that make Maverick Studios smarter, more consistent, and more scalable.

  • Deadline Defender:Manage multiple reviews andshiftingpriorities without compromising accuracy or attention to detail.

  • Collaborative Quality Champion:Build trusted partnerships across Creative, Production, Operations, Client Relations, and Brand teams. Provide clear, constructive feedback that helps elevate the work and strengthenthe customerexperience.

About Inspire Brands

Sourced by ZipRecruiter

Inspire Brands Inc., located in Atlanta, GA, United States, operates in the foodservice industry as a multi-brand restaurant company, making it among the biggest restaurant companies globally. Their portfolio includes well-known restaurant brands such as Arby's, Buffalo Wild Wings, Sonic, and Jimmy John's, reflecting their commitment to innovation and quality. Founded in 2018 as a result of a consolidation of various restaurant brands under one corporate umbrella, Inspire Brands was formed with a vision to invigorate excellent brands and supercharge their long-term growth.
